6 Common and Easy Ways How to Prevent Laptop Hinges from Breaking

1. Don’t Open or Close the Laptop lid With too Much Force

Overusing your laptop’s lid can cause long-term damage. The hinges hold the display in place while opening and closing smoothly. Too much pressure can bend or break hinges.

The display’s casing can crack if opened or closed too forcefully. Be gentle when opening and closing your laptop; your future self will thank you.

The hinges of a laptop are its weakest point. They support the screen and allow 360-degree rotation. Plastic ones can break easily if not handled carefully.

Best to carry the laptop by the base. This will distribute the weight away from the hinges. Most hinge accidents occur when opening and closing the lid.

Use both hands, and don’t overpress the top. You can avoid breaking your laptop’s hinges with a bit of care.

How do I know if my laptop’s hinges are failing?

A: Laptop hinges can fail for several reasons. These include creaking or grinding noises when opening or closing the laptop, cracked or gapped hinges, and wobbling or shaking screens. Repair your laptop if you observe any of these symptoms.
